[Digital Times, Kim Eun] Korean device makers are expected to record record-high earnings in the second quarter, following the first quarter of this year, as Samsung Electronics and SK Hynix boosted semiconductor facility investment.
According to the Financial Supervisory Service`s electronic disclosure system, semiconductor device maker Hanmi Semiconductor recorded the highest quarterly earnings since its establishment, with sales of KRW 60.9 billion in the second quarter of this year. Sales and operating profit increased by 41.7% and 91.7%, respectively compared with the same period last year. This is due to sales of new equipment such as `TSV (Electrode Through) Dual Stacking TC Bonders` jointly developed with SK Hynix last year and the 6th generation New Vision Placement introduced earlier this year has increased.
SFA Engineering, the largest semiconductor equipment maker in Korea, has also surpassed KRW 1 trillion in sales for the first time last year. The company recorded sales of KRW 461.5 billion in the first quarter of this year, up 124 % from the same period last year.
Meanwhile, Semes also surpassed KRW 1 trillion in sales last year after reaching 2015, and it is expected to achieve record sales this year.
Semiconductor device maker Tesco is projected to post record quarterly operating profit of KRW 21.4 billion in the second quarter. It recorded a record-high quarterly record of KRW 63.8 billion in sales and operating profit of KRW 15.7 billion in the first quarter as Samsung Electronics` investment on the first floor of the Pyeongtaek plant was accelerated in the first half of the year. The company is expected to post record sales of KRW 84.8 billion and operating profit of KRW 22.4 billion in the second quarter.
Besides, Wonik IPS¡¯ the second quarter operating profit is projected to increase by more than 30% to KRW 40.1 billion and revenues to reach KRW 192 billion. On the other hand, Jusung Engineering also signed a contract to supply semiconductor atomic layer deposition equipment (ALD) to SK Hynix this year. Sales in the second quarter are expected to reach KRW 75.7 billion, up 15% from last year`s KRW 309.2 billion.
KC Tech also actively supplied semiconductor devices and materials to Samsung Electronics and SK Hynix, resulting in sales of KRW 186.4 billion, an increase of 107.8% from KRW 89.7 billion in the first quarter of last year. In the second quarter, earnings continued to rise, reaching KRW 651.1 billion in sales this year, surpassing KRW 487.5 billion last year. The AP system is also expected to turn around in the first quarter and is expected to continue to improve in the second quarter.
Semiconductor device makers` earnings increased this year as Samsung Electronics and SK Hynix increased their memory capital investment significantly. Samsung Electronics plans to invest KRW 14.4 trillion in Pyeongtaek Semiconductor Complex by 2021 and KRW 6 trillion in Hwaseong Site to secure new facilities for the production of products below 7nm. SK Hynix plans to invest around KRW 7 trillion in facility investment, including its new plant in Cheongju this year.
An industry expert said, "Korean device makers will continue to perform well in the first half of next year. We should continue to work on product diversification and technology development, and not let China or Taiwan companies hit the global equipment market."
